Comprehending UPVC Door Panels
UPVC door panels are built from a strong, high-density product resistant to weather aspects, decay, and rust. They supply excellent insulation and need minimal upkeep, making them a favorite for both domestic and industrial residential or commercial properties.
Benefits of UPVC Door PanelsBenefitsDescriptionSturdinessResistant to rotting, warping, and rust.Energy EfficiencyExcellent thermal insulation residential or commercial properties.Low MaintenanceNeeds minimal maintenance compared to wooden doors.Cost-efficientGenerally less expensive than wooden or metal doors.Variety of DesignsOffered in various colors and finishes.Indications Your UPVC Door Panel Needs Renovation
Acknowledging when your UPVC door panel needs renovation is essential to keeping the integrity and aesthetic of your home. Below prevail signs that indicate it might be time for an upgrade:
Fading and Discoloration: Exposure to sunlight and weather condition components can cause the color of the UPVC to fade.Cracks and Chips: Physical damage from impacts can result in cracks or chips in the panel.Dirt and Stains: Accumulated dirt or discolorations that can not be cleaned easily might decrease the door's appeal.Deforming: Changes in temperature level and humidity can trigger the panel to warp, impacting its operation.Increased Drafts: A compromised seal can cause drafts, resulting in higher energy expenses.Actions for UPVC Door Panel Renovation
Remodeling your UPVC Door Repair door panel can be a straightforward procedure if approached systematically. Below are the steps you ought to follow:
1. Prepare Your Work AreaCollect Tools and Materials: You'll need cleaning services, a soft cloth, sandpaper, guide, paint (if needed), and a sealant.2. Tidy the Door PanelUtilize a soft fabric and a mixture of warm water and mild cleaning agent to clean up the surface thoroughly. This step guarantees that any dirt or gunk does not interfere with the restoration.3. Check for DamageExamine the panel for any cracks, chips, or warping. If you discover any significant damage, it may be much better to change the panel completely.4. Sand Down Rough AreasIf you observe any rough patches or flaking paint, gently sand these locations to create a smooth surface. Use fine-grit sandpaper to prevent damaging the UPVC.5. Apply PrimerIf you're painting the door or fixing a specific area, apply a coat of primer matched for UPVC Door Repair. Permit sufficient drying time as per the maker's instructions.6. Paint the PanelPick a paint developed for UPVC surface areas. Apply uniformly utilizing a brush or roller, beginning with one coat and enabling it to dry before using another if required.7. Seal Any GapsIf there are any gaps or cracks, fill them with an ideal sealant to avoid moisture intrusion and improve energy performance.8. Last InspectionOnce dry, perform a final evaluation to make sure the panel has been refurbished properly and looks aesthetically pleasing.Tips for Maintaining Your UPVC Door Panel
Regular maintenance can extend the life of your UPVC door panel. Here are some practical tips:
Regular Cleaning: Clean your door panel every few months to prevent dirt accumulation.Check Seals: Periodically examine the seals around the panel to guarantee they are undamaged and working.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Stick to mild cleaner as severe chemicals can damage the UPVC surface.Usage Protective Coatings: Some house owners go with protective finishings that can improve durability and resistance to fading.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. For how long do UPVC door panels last?
UPVC door panels can last anywhere from 20 to 30 years, depending upon maintenance and ecological conditions.
2. Can I paint my UPVC door panel?
Yes, you can paint a UPVC door panel. Nevertheless, make sure to utilize paint created specifically for UPVC surfaces for optimum outcomes.
3. Is it required to replace the entire door if the panel is harmed?
Not always. If the damage is very little and repairable, you can remodel the panel instead of change the whole door.
4. What are the costs connected with UPVC door panel restoration?
Costs can vary based on materials and labor. A DIY approach can be affordable, while working with professionals will increase costs considerably.
5. Can I utilize regular cleansing items on UPVC?
Prevent severe or abrasive cleaners. Stay with mild soaps or UPVC-specific cleansing products to avoid damage to the surface.
